Review - Toy Castle

Level Design: 13/20

The level design was pretty neat overall; the obstacles were well thought out and fun to play through for the most part, and the level was pretty unique with the toy gimmick and the different sprites. This level has some great level design, and I would gladly give it a higher score, but there are some design issues holding me back.

The hole where the player goes down after the first key is filled with spiny eggs, which are pretty much impossible to avoid. Even if the player manages to avoid them, it's hard not to take a hit when they fall to the ground anyway, giving the player a blind hit. Simply removing them would fix that.

The second section of the level (after the midway point) was too cramped and annoying to play through. There was hardly any space to move around, specially if the player is big, and most of the obstacles there seem to be just thrown out without any real thought, to be honest. It's also pretty repetitive when compared with the first one, as it doesn't really add anything to the level or expand on the level's gimmick, so I recommend simply removing it.

The 'second boss fight' felt a bit unnecessary and I believe the level would be better without it. The first one already provided enough of a challenge and ending it there would probably be better.

Atmosphere: 8/10

The atmosphere was very nice overall, with a colorful and vibrant feel which reminds me of something I could see on a Kirby game. The tileset was also well done, and I couldn't find any noticeable glitches or cutoff. The music also seems to fit well, but it seems a bit too repetitive. Nothing really wrong there, the atmosphere was very nice throughout.

Score: 7/10 - Approved

While the level design was great and it started pretty nice, it seemed to get more and more repetitive, as the level didn't introduce anything new to keep the player interested. I would love to give this a higher score, but there are simply way too many design issues, specially on the second half of it.
